Essential Metrics: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)
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) play a crucial role in quantifying the success of your social media initiatives. These metrics provide valuable insights into how effectively your strategy is functioning and enable you to make informed, data-driven decisions. Common KPIs include engagement rates, follower growth, and conversion rates.
Engagement rates indicate how well your audience interacts with your content; for example, a high engagement rate suggests that your posts resonate with users. Follower growth tracks the number of new followers gained over time, reflecting your brand's appeal. Conversion rates measure the percentage of users who take desired actions, such as clicking a link or completing a purchase, directly attributable to your social media efforts.
By consistently monitoring these KPIs, you can identify trends, recognize successful strategies, and adjust your approach to optimize performance effectively.

How to Measure Engagement Rates Effectively
Calculating engagement rates is vital for clearly understanding your content's performance. To measure engagement effectively, divide the total number of engagements (likes, comments, shares) by the total reach or impressions. This calculation provides a percentage that indicates how well your content resonates with viewers.
A higher engagement rate signifies a more engaged audience, making it an essential metric to monitor consistently. Analyzing engagement rates can highlight successful content and identify areas that require improvement. For example, if certain posts yield higher engagement rates, it signals the need to produce similar content in the future.
Tracking engagement trends over time also helps in understanding shifts in audience behavior, enabling timely adjustments to your overall strategy.

Understanding Reach and Impressions
What Is the Distinction Between Reach and Impressions?
Reach and impressions are fundamental metrics in social media measurement, serving distinct purposes. Reach measures the number of unique users who see your content, while impressions count the total number of times your content is displayed, regardless of whether the same user views it multiple times.
Grasping this difference is critical because it helps you evaluate the effectiveness of your social media strategy. A high reach suggests that your content is reaching many unique users, which is advantageous for boosting brand awareness. Conversely, a high number of impressions indicates that your content is being viewed or shared multiple times, signaling strong interest.
Both metrics should be closely monitored, as they provide insights into your content's visibility and help inform future content strategy.

How to Effectively Track Conversions
Effectively tracking conversions requires implementing specific tools and strategies to monitor user actions accurately. A common method is utilizing UTM parameters, which help attribute conversions to particular social media efforts. By adding these parameters to your URLs, you can track the source of conversions when users click through to your website.
Additionally, employing analytics tools such as Google Analytics can provide in-depth insights into conversion pathways. Setting up conversion goals in these tools enables you to clearly measure the effectiveness of your social media campaigns by tracking conversion events—like purchases, sign-ups, or downloads—which provides a granular understanding of user interactions with your content. By analyzing this data, you can refine your strategies to optimize for higher conversion rates by addressing potential drop-off points in the user journey.

What Are UTM Parameters, and How Do They Help Track Conversions?
UTM parameters are tags added to URLs that help track campaign performance in analytics tools. They allow brands to determine where traffic originates and measure the effectiveness of specific social media efforts.
How Can I Measure the ROI of My Social Media Efforts?
To measure ROI, calculate the revenue generated from social media campaigns minus the costs associated with those campaigns, which may include ad spend, content creation, and influencer partnerships.
